Size Reduction Equipment
Size reduction equipment refers to machines designed to decrease the size of various materials. Historically, people used basic tools like stones for breaking down larger objects. Today, modern size reduction equipment features advanced technology and is essential in industries such as mining, food processing, and chemical manufacturing for efficient material processing.

Types of Size Reduction Equipment
There are several categories of size reduction equipment, each tailored for specific processes. The most common types include crushers, grinders, and shredders. Below is a more detailed explanation of each type.
- Crushers:
- Crushers are machines used to break down large materials into smaller, manageable pieces. Major types include jaw crushers, gyratory crushers, and cone crushers. Jaw crushers are often utilized in mining and quarry operations, while gyratory crushers are preferred for heavy-duty crushing. Cone crushers are typically chosen for secondary or tertiary crushing and recycling applications.
- Grinders:
- Grinders are equipment designed to mill materials into fine particles. Frequently used in the chemical, pharmaceutical, and food sectors, common types include ball mills, hammer mills, and disk mills. Ball mills are ideal for creating fine powders, hammer mills are used to process tough materials like wood or plastic, and disk mills are suitable for grinding softer materials such as grains and seeds.
- Shredders:
- Shredders are machines that break down large items into smaller pieces, widely used in recycling operations for materials such as paper, cardboard, and plastic. Types include single-shaft, double-shaft, and quad-shaft shredders. Single-shaft shredders handle softer materials, double-shaft shredders process harder items, and quad-shaft shredders offer the flexibility to handle a diverse range of materials.
Limitations of Size Reduction Equipment
Although size reduction equipment offers significant advantages, there are also some drawbacks. Crushers typically require high energy input and have a limited reduction ratio. Grinders can be loud and may need frequent maintenance. Shredders can consume substantial power and may not be capable of processing certain material types.

Applications of Size Reduction Equipment
Size reduction equipment is essential in industries such as recycling, mining, food processing, pharmaceuticals, and chemical production. Below are details on how it is applied in each sector.
- Recycling Industry
- In recycling, size reduction equipment is vital for processing bulky waste like plastics, metals, and rubber. Shredders break down paper, cardboard, and plastic for easier transport and processing. Crushers and grinders crush and grind items like scrap metal and electronic waste into smaller fragments for further recycling steps.
- Mining Industry
- The mining sector relies on size reduction equipment to process rocks and ores. Crushers reduce large rocks into smaller pieces, which are then ground or separated by other machinery. Grinders help turn minerals into fine powder for extraction and processing.
- Food Processing Industry
- In food production, size reduction equipment is used to prepare ingredients for processing and packaging. Grinders mill products like spices, grains, and coffee to precise sizes, while crushers break down solid foods such as fruits and vegetables for further handling.
- Pharmaceutical Manufacturing Industry
- Pharmaceutical companies use size reduction equipment to process drugs and chemicals for easier handling. Crushers and grinders turn substances into powder for formulation, often improving solubility and bioavailability for greater effectiveness.
- Chemical Production Industry
- In chemical manufacturing, crushers reduce large chemical chunks and grinders create uniform particle sizes for processing and blending, enhancing the quality and consistency of chemical products.
